Hey Marta — handing over the fleet fuel-usage report for Haulwise before I head out. The aggregation job now rolls up per-vehicle liters daily instead of weekly, so the numbers in the Tallgrove depot view should finally match the dispatcher totals. One gotcha: idling time is still estimated, not measured, so flag anything that looks off by more than 5%. Tests pass locally and in staging. Full context, open questions, and the diff summary are on the internal handover page.

runbook for badug-kadup: https://confluence.zemvarlabs.internal/projects/browse/display/projects/bd1b

Subject: Change of responsibilities — Ledgerline payroll export

Welcome aboard. As of next week, ownership of the Ledgerline payroll export is shifting ahead of the format change from fixed-width to the new delimited schema. Please note that both formats must run in parallel through two full pay cycles, and that any field-mapping changes require written sign-off before deployment. Do not modify the legacy exporter directly. All format questions and sign-off requests should be directed to:

signatory, bajof-yahif: Zorael Wenael

Prepared for heads of department. The twelve-week pilot with the Fernhollow retail chain concluded on schedule. Shelf-placement analytics from our Lanternwick platform ran in eighteen stores without major incident; uptime held at target levels. Fernhollow's buying team has signalled interest in a wider rollout, pending commercial terms. Integration costs came in slightly over estimate, offset by lower training spend. Decision on contract scope is expected at the next review. The strategic context appears below.

board note of kageg-bahof: The renewal with Holwynax Holdings closes at $2 million a year, 5 percent below the last contract. Project Ulaath slips by two quarters because of the supplier delay.